Hello all. I am a newb to the forum thing. This weekend I am purchasing a 2004 F150 XLT 4X4 5.4L 112,000 miles. It has been owned by a member of my family for the past 6 years. It has been driven very little in that time. The body is in great shape. The engine seems to run great. No noise from the phasers or or VCT's.

It does have a issue that I am torn over. It will drain the battery within 5 days if not started. They had it to the mechanic recently and they disconnected the aftermarket back up camera. Thought was maybe the camera is causing a parasitic drain. Also It has a viper alarm system. I will remove that as well if the camera does not solve the issue.

I know where it was purchased new and had most of the 90,000 miles serviced at so I will try and get the service records or a least they can tell me what all has been repaired on the truck.

What type brand and weight of oil should be used?
What else should I look at on this vehicle?

I am a little nervous. I am paying 6K for the truck.

You thoughts are greatly appreciated.

Welcome Steele, most 5.4 3V owners run 5W-20 motorcraft synthetic blend oil and a motorcraft oil filter that can be bought at Walmart. Once you obtain the maint. records we can look at what needs to be serviced. where you at in Va. ?
